What Is CPR? Comprehending the Basics
CPR represents cardiopulmonary resuscitation, a treatment developed to bring back breathing and flow in an individual who has actually stopped breathing or whose heart has actually discontinued beating. The method includes breast compressions incorporated with fabricated ventilation methods such as mouth-to-mouth breathing or using a bag-mask device.
- Key Elements of CPR: Chest Compressions: These assist maintain blood circulation to crucial organs. Rescue Breaths: These give oxygen to the lungs. Automated Outside Defibrillator (AED): A device that can shock the heart back into rhythm in instance of particular heart arrests.
Misconception 1: Only Physician Can Do CPR
One usual myth is that just skilled physician can carry out CPR properly. While doctor are absolutely knowledgeable at it, any person can learn exactly how to carry out mouth-to-mouth resuscitation with CPR courses

- The Fact: Laypersons can be educated to administer effective CPR. Basic strategies are uncomplicated and can be understood by any person willing to learn. Bystanders often play crucial roles in saving lives prior to professional assistance arrives.
Misconception 2: CPR Is Only Valuable for Heart Attack Victims
Another prevalent misunderstanding is that CPR is exclusively for people experiencing cardiac arrest. In reality, mouth-to-mouth resuscitation can be valuable in numerous emergencies.
- Other Scenarios Where mouth-to-mouth resuscitation Works: Drowning incidents Drug overdoses Choking sufferers where the respiratory tract has been compromised
Misconception 3: You Must Avoid Providing Rescue Breaths
Many individuals think rescue breaths are unneeded or perhaps hazardous as a result of the risk of infection or various other problems. This originates from confusion regarding exactly how COVID-19 might influence these practices.
- The Truths: Rescue breaths are important for offering oxygen. During instances like sinking or opioid overdose, rescue breaths end up being crucial. Hands-only mouth-to-mouth resuscitation is suggested when someone is untrained or hesitant yet recognizing both methods stays vital.
Misconception 4: You Can't Damage Someone by Executing Mouth-to-mouth Resuscitation Incorrectly
While it holds true that carrying out CPR improperly might cause some harm, not attempting it whatsoever might cause death.
- Understanding the Dangers: Rib fractures might take place throughout hostile chest compressions. Any activity taken is better than not doing anything; modern standards emphasize that "something" is far better than "nothing" during heart attack situations.
Misconception 5: When You're Educated, You Do Not Required Additional Training
Some people think that once they have actually completed a program, they don't require more training or recertification.
- Why Ongoing Training Issues: Techniques advance with time based on new research. Regular refresher courses keep your abilities sharp and ensure you're current with current best practices.
Misconception 6: Children Do Not Required Mouth-to-mouth Resuscitation Training
Parents often think they will not need to execute mouth-to-mouth resuscitation on their children due to the fact that children don't experience cardiac occasions as frequently as grownups do.
- The Fact for Parents: Children can experience respiratory system concerns, choking incidents, or drowning situations calling for prompt attention. Learning pediatric-specific methods ensures preparedness throughout emergency situations entailing children.

FAQ 1: What kind of training do I require for efficient CPR?
You needs to enroll in identified CPR courses that cover both adult and kid resuscitation techniques effectively.
FAQ 2: Exactly how frequently need to I restore my emergency treatment certificate?
It's recommended to restore your first aid certificate every two years given that guidelines alter regularly based upon emerging research.
FAQ 3: Is hands-only compression better than typical CPR?
For inexperienced bystanders or those unpleasant offering rescue breaths, hands-only compression works but recognizing both techniques provides a higher opportunity of survival if educated properly.
FAQ 4: What resources are available for learning about very first aid?
Numerous organizations supply online resources alongside physical courses; trusted systems consist of the American Heart Organization and Red Cross websites which detail first help courses readily available near you.
FAQ 5: Exist any kind of age restrictions on taking an emergency treatment course?
Most first help courses welcome individuals of every ages; however, some specialized courses might be tailored toward specific age (e.g., children vs grownups).
FAQ 6: Does my workplace need me to obtain certified?
Certain offices-- particularly those including public interaction-- commonly need employees to have valid accreditations in emergency treatment and standard life support (BLS).
